Output 516b821291d6ac7388b7817e15c10e506d6b33efe69af32b8075a051c2e82846:0

value
2217548
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 75043a0b90d02b16f857f89b93bef7b7d844a66f OP_EQUALVERIFY OP_CHECKSIG
address
1Bfj889DVzvKPsKtHu8AtrGbgRMxvcyVxK
transaction
516b821291d6ac7388b7817e15c10e506d6b33efe69af32b8075a051c2e82846
spent
true